About This Wine

Château Cap de Mourlin is a Saint‑Émilion Grand Cru Classé from Bordeaux’s Right Bank, a family‑owned estate producing Merlot‑dominated blends (typically ~65–85% Merlot with Cabernet Franc and some Cabernet Sauvignon) from clay‑limestone soils; the wine is known for ripe dark‑fruit concentration, supple yet structured tannins and oak‑driven spice from French barrel ageing, offering approachable richness with good aging potential.Learn More »
